The question

A public-benefit agency must classify incoming applications within two seconds, including during intermittent network outages. The model processes sensitive case data, and staff must approve adverse eligibility actions. Which deployment distinction best fits these constraints, while preserving required controls?

Preparing for AIGP? Take the free 5-min readiness quiz →

  1. Use a local model because local storage automatically satisfies governance requirements.
    Local processing can improve availability and control, but location alone does not satisfy privacy, security, validation, or oversight requirements.
  2. Use a cloud model because centralized infrastructure simplifies maintenance.
    Central maintenance may help, but outage sensitivity and latency requirements make connectivity and dependency risks unresolved.
  3. Evaluate an edge-capable deployment, then validate latency, privacy, and review controls.
    Edge processing may address latency and outages, but suitability still depends on testing data controls and preserving human approval.
  4. Use an open model on agency servers to avoid external dependencies entirely.
    An open model may reduce some supplier dependence, but agency operation still requires evaluation, security, monitoring, and approval controls.
The trap
Choose the architecture that addresses the stated constraint, then retain contextual testing and consequential-action oversight.
